Major Characters

Jack is an eight-year-old boy living in Frog Creek, Pennsylvania. Characterized by his methodical nature, he loves facts, reading, and taking careful notes in his trusty notebook. He is naturally cautious and often hesitant to embrace danger, relying on a red backpack filled with reference books to help him understand his surroundings. His logical approach balances his younger sister's impulsivity during their magical adventures.

Annie is a boisterous, imaginative seven-year-old girl with blond pigtails who loves make-believe. She is bold and impulsive, frequently charging ahead into magical environments without hesitation. Her daring nature often propels the siblings into action, as she prefers learning through direct experience rather than reading about it.

Supporting Characters

The Knight is a mysterious and gallant figure clad in shining armor. Operating in silence with a face entirely hidden by a metal visor, he embodies the romanticized ideals of medieval chivalry and heroism. His majestic presence simultaneously inspires awe in the children and provides critical assistance when they are lost on the castle grounds.

Red is a castle guard tasked with defending the medieval stronghold from intruders. Earning his nickname from his very red face, he is threatening and stern, attempting to imprison the children in a damp, clammy dungeon. Despite his intimidating physical demeanor, he proves highly superstitious.

Mustache is a medieval castle guard identified by his prominent facial hair. Paranoid about foreign enemies, he marches the children toward the dungeon while interrogating them about their origins. Like his companions, he is easily frightened by modern technology he does not understand.

Squinty is a castle guard recognizable by his squinting eyes. Tasked with protecting the duke's stronghold, he aggressively interrogates the children and helps drag them to the cold dungeon. His lack of understanding of tools from the future allows the siblings to escape his custody.
